The “22" hat is the coveted headwear Taylor Swift fans hope to receive when attending the Eras Tour in stadiums across the world. During Taylor Swift’s magnum opus, she dons the “Red” era fedora along with one of six bejeweled T-shirts: "We are never getting back together like ever," "A lot going on at the moment," "Who’s Taylor Swift anyway? Ew," "This is not Taylor's Version," "I bet you think about me," and "I knew U were trouble."

As the singer skips down the catwalk with her dancers, a lucky fan waits at the end of the stage crying and dancing. When Swift arrives, she takes off the hat, places it on the fan's head and exchanges a friendship bracelet along with a core memory for the chosen Swiftie.

Eight-three hat recipients were selected in 2023 and the beginning of 2024. There are 69 lucky fans left to be crowned as the 3 1/2 hour show heads to Europe and North America.

‘Dress up like hipsters’

Swift signs every brim with a metallic Sharpie. There’s a chic black tag sewn on the inside with the signature of Mexican-American haute couture milliner Gladys Tamez . It also reads “Handmade in Los Angeles.” Tamez is based in the California city and makes a collection of luxury head coverings that cost from $255 to $1550. While the "22" hat is one-of-a-kind, you can get a similar one called “Classic Fedora” for $385.

"I've been like so, so humble and so grateful to do this," says Tamez about being chosen to make the "22" fedora, "because I've worked with her team for a long time and then to have this moment, I was so excited."

One of the timeless, luxurious hats takes about 8-9 hours to mold by hand.

"There's not that many things in the world right now that are handmade," Tamez says. "I want to keep it going."

‘We’re happy, free, confused and lonely at the same time’

How are the fans chosen? Usually, it's random. Fans in the audience (usually dancing on the floor) are hand plucked by Swift's team. In other cases, Swifties have been picked because they went viral demonstrating their fandom to the superstar or they have incredibly inspiring stories. Then there’s those like Selena Gomez's sister, Gracie, or Kobe and Vanessa Bryant’s daughter, Bianka, who have a special bond with Swift. 

“This lady came and tapped me on the shoulder,” Sarah Frances said in a TikTok explaining how she was randomly chosen for the hat in Atlanta. If you really want to know where Frances was April 29, she was on the floor dancing when a member of Swift's team discovered her.

“She asked me if I could go take a walk with her, which I thought I was in trouble for doing something,” she said. “I thought I was about to go to Taylor jail.”

The same thing happened in Chicago when Tina Avila surprised her daughter Isa with tickets. They were dancing when someone came up to them during the "Speak Now" era.

“It was random,” Avila said in the comments. “We did nothing special but sing our heart outs!”

In Pittsburgh , halfway through “Enchanted," someone came over to Renata Guarlotti and her daughter Katie and said, “I’m with Taylor’s crew, can you come with us? You will want to video this.”

In Minneapolis, Austin ( @austinandmikemn on TikTok ) noticedSwift's parents Andrea and Scott Swift entering the stadium and jumped up-and-down ecstatically asking to trade bracelets. During the concert, Austin was invited to the VIP tent to watch with Swift's parents and then before "22," he was escorted to the end of the stage. Austin smartly brought a Sharpie and asked Swift to sign his shirt.

On night three in Sydney, Swift's team chose Lily Gearside, the 5-year-old Aussie who went viral for her award-winning speech on Taylor Swift. The adorable video caught the attention of the superstar who commented and liked a few of the posts on TikTok. Lily’s mom, Jessica, mentioned where their seats were on social media and tagged Taylor Nation, Swift's marketing account. The mom and daughter had no idea that Lily would be chosen, and they were in the nosebleeds when a woman on Swift’s team came up to them during the “Lover” era. The worker asked them to grab their belongings.

“She takes us to a private lift and we get in with a security guard and it takes us from the 400 section to the ground level,” Jessica explains on TikTok . “We walk through these back sections and arrive at a door that leads to the floor.”

Jessica and Lily were handed wristbands that said “The Fearless Lounge” and escorted to the VIP tent where Swift’s dad Scott wanted to make sure Lily could see the stage. During “Long Live,” a team member came to get Lily and Jessica and lead them past the barricade to the stage.

Taylor Swift kicked off her Eras Tour in Glendale, Ariz. last night, delivering a 44-song set that lasted more than three hours. Somehow, the only time Swift paused throughout the night was to make a quick outfit change, disappearing into thin air only to return in a brand-new (and often bejeweled) look.

Instead of journeying through her 10 albums chronologically, Swift opted to mix up her musical eras, starting with 2019’s “Lover” before transitioning into 2020’s “Evermore.” “Reputation” was up next, followed by a short stint in “Speak Now,” during which she only performed “Enchanted.” Songs from “Red,” “Folklore” and “1989” came after, and then Swift performed a short acoustic set consisting of “Mirrorball” and “Tim McGraw” from her first, self-titled album — a tradition she said she’ll change up for every show, without repeating a song. Swift ended the night with her most recent release, “Midnights,” bringing fans back to the present.

Taylor Swift Gave Kobe and Vanessa Bryant’s Daughter Her ‘Red’-Era Fedora

By Jon Blistein

Jon Blistein

Taylor Swift graciously bestowed her honorary Red -era fedora to Kobe and Vanessa Bryant ’s daughter, Bianka, during her Eras Tour show in Los Angeles Thursday night, Aug. 3.

Video of the incredibly sweet moment was shared widely on social media, with Taylor meeting Bianka side stage at the end of “22,” giving her a hug and placing the hat — designed by Gladys Tamez — on her head. Vanessa Bryant shared a photo of the hug on Instagram as well, writing in the caption, “We love you @taylorswift ❤️”

Meet the LA designer behind Taylor Swift's '22' hat that's changing lives: 'It's been beautiful'

LOS ANGELES (KABC) -- Before Taylor Swift takes the stage during her highly anticipated "Eras Tour," you'll likely hear fans ask, "Who's going to get the hat tonight?"

During the first show of Swift's concert series at SoFi Stadium, the Grammy winner shared a special moment with Bianka Bryant, daughter of Kobe and Vanessa Bryant.

While performing her song "22," Swift gave the hat she was wearing to Bianka. The exchange quickly went viral online.

READ MORE | Taylor Swift shares poignant moment with Bianka Bryant, daughter of Kobe and Vanessa, at concert

taylor swift red eras tour hat

Giving the "22" hat to a fan during each live performance has become a tradition for the singer and the creator of those hats said it was an incredible honor to be part of such a tender moment.

"I woke up to that beautiful news, I was so excited because for me, I've been growing up watching Kobe, and it was so sad for me what happened," said Gladys Tamez, who runs Gladys Tamez Millinery in Los Angeles .

Tamez's hat design is worn by Swift every night. Swift's team reached out to the designer during the planning stage of the tour, needing enough hats to go around.

"I was like, 'Oh my God, how many? How are we going to do it? I had lots of questions, but I have the best materials ..."

She also has plenty of experience. Her designs have been worn by stars like Lady Gaga, Lil Nas X and Billy Ray Cyrus.

Tamez has always had love for her craft and through the "Eras Tour," she's been able to witness that love be shared with so many young, deserving fans across the country.

"It means a lot because with my designs, I've touched somebody's heart, you know? It's been beautiful."

Scoring a ticket to the Eras Tour may have felt like the eighth circle of hell , but it sounds like Taylor Swift's opening night was pure heaven on earth. 

On March 18, Swift kicked off the tour in Glendale, Arizona (a.k.a. Swift City ), performing for a crowd of 80,000 for the first time since her last tour in 2008. Celebrating all 10 of her albums—including the latest LP, Midnights —Swift's set included 44 songs, 16 backup dancers, and at least 13 outfit changes. According to People , the entire show lasted three hours and 13 minutes, which, of course, is the artist's favorite number. 

The trick to the quick change is keeping everything else simple, as Keira Knightley would agree . Throughout the entire night, Swift wore her hair straight, her eyeliner winged, and her lips her signature shade of red. Here's everything Taylor Swift wore and sang on the first night of the Eras Tour. Warning: Set list spoilers past this point.

Taylor Swift Eras Tour

According to Elle , Swift began with Lover , taking audiences through “Miss Americana & The Heartbreak Prince,” “Cruel Summer,” “The Man,” “You Need to Calm Down,” “Lover,” and “The Archer.” To represent the album, People reports, Swift wore a sparkling Versace bodysuit before switching into a boardroom-approved sparkling suit jacket perfect for “The Man.” Personally, I'm drawn to her sparkling Christian Louboutin boots, which appeared multiple times throughout the night. 

Taylor Swift Eras Tour

For Fearless , Swift rocked a golden Alberta Ferretti fringe dress to perform “Fearless,” “You Belong With Me,” and “Love Story.” Baby, just say yes. 

Taylor Swift Eras Tour

Swift then opted for a sweet embroidered orange corset dress to perform multiple songs off Evermore for the first time live, including “’Tis The Damn Season,” “Willow,” “Marjorie,” “Champagne Problems,” and “Tolerate It.”

Taylor Swift Eras Tour

Perhaps the most interesting look Swift rocked, however, was the asymmetrical, half-leg bodysuit she changed into for her Reputation era. The pop star reportedly belted out “Look What You Made Me Do” in a black sequined ensemble covered in vibrant red snakes, which seem to reference her infamous feud with Kim Kardashian and Kanye West .

In stark contrast, Swift referenced her sequined Valentino look from the Speak Now tour with a romantic gown by Nicole + Felicia, per People . “Enchanted,” indeed. 

Taylor Swift Eras Tour

Based on the photos, my favorite portion of the night came when Swift embraced her Red era. To start, she performed “22” in a new version of her sequined T-shirt from the 2013 music video , switching the text from “Not a lot going on at the moment” to “A lot going on at the moment.”

Taylor Swift Eras Tour

After passing her hat off to a fan , Swift removed the shirt to reveal a black and red sequined Ashish romper for “We Are Never Getting Back Together” and “I Knew You Were Trouble” before adding a matching long coat for the full 10-minute version of “All Too Well.”

Taylor Swift Eras Tour

Next came Folklore. Swift reportedly performed all seven of her chosen songs—“Invisible String,” “Betty,” “The Last Great American Dynasty,” “August,” “Illicit Affairs,” “My Tears Ricochet,” and “Cardigan”—in a dreamy lavender dress by Alberta Ferretti.

“A sort of a running theme in my music is that I love to explain to men how to apologize,” Swift told the crowd of “Betty.” “I just love it. It's kind of my thing. I love to tell them, step-by-step, here's how simple this is to fix things. If you just follow these easy steps that I'm laying out for you in a three-minute song…. Just love the idea of men apologizing.” 

Taylor Swift Eras Tour

For 1989, Swift kept things light and fun, performing “Style, “Blank Space,” “Shake It Off,” “Wildest Dreams,” and “Bad Blood” in a pink crystal skirt and top set by Roberto Cavalli. 

Taylor Swift Eras Tour

Swift followed up 1989 with an acoustic performance of “Mirrorball.” However, she told the audience she plans on switching things up for each show.

Have You Ever Wondered How Taylor Swift Chooses Who Gets The ‘22’ Hat On The Eras Tour? Lucky Fans Shared Their Stories

Taking notes.

Taylor Swift’s Eras Tour has many traditions. The pop star always plays two surprise songs at every show, she always dives into the stage for a costume change, and she always gives her black hat to a fan during “22.” There are tens of thousands of fans in the stadium during a given concert, so being the “Lucky One” chosen to be gifted Swift’s hat is almost impossible. So, how does the singer’s team choose the person who gets the famous hat? Let’s break it down.

SAO PAULO, BRAZIL - NOVEMBER 24: (EDITORIAL USE ONLY. NO COVERS.) A young fan exchanges friendship bracelets with Taylor Swift as she performs onstage during

How Taylor Swift Chooses Who Gets The “22” Hat According To One Young Fan

Like the lil Swiftie pictured above, Grace DelVecchio is a 12-year-old girl from Yorktown, New York, who was picked out of the crowd to receive the “Red” singer's hat during "22." Her family told a local Yorktown publication, TapInto Yorktown, that the moment was actually "a long time coming." DelVecchio has a special story, and she has loved Swift for years. When the family was fortunate to snag tickets to the Era’s Tour, the 12-year-old’s speech pathologist, Jenn Sparano, looked for a way for DelVecchio to meet the Midnights artist. She said:

I started reaching out to different background dancers. I was emailing the Taylor Swift PR team. I was messaging Taylor Swift. But I obviously didn’t hear back from anyone.

While she may not have heard from Swift’s team, the New York Post found DelVecchio’s story that Sparano posted on Facebook, and published an article about it. Still, there was no word from the Swift camp. 

That all changed when security found the young girl and her father during the concert and brought her to the front of the stadium for a special moment. She was brought to the front, and the Grammy winner handed DelVecchio her hat, which she now keeps in a shadow box. Reflecting on the moment the special gal said: 

I was shaking, I was so nervous to see her. It made me feel special.

That is such a remarkable moment and clearly, the campaigning worked. I’m sure the process for choosing someone to keep the hat is slightly different for every show, but this is some great insight into how moments like these come to fruition. Swift often chooses very young fans to receive her hat, making for an adorable picture-perfect memory that the fan will likely never forget. 

Taylor Swift performing

Sometimes People Swift Knows Personally Get The “22” Hat

While the majority of the “22” hat recipients come from the crowd and are kids who idolize Swift, sometimes the singer bestows part of her costume on someone she knows personally. 

For example, when Swift’s bestie Selena Gomez brought her 9-year-old sister Gracie to a show, that’s who the pop star gave her hat to.

Also, when the Eras Tour was in LA, Swift gave her hat to Kobe Bryant’s daughter Bianka, as the “22” singer and the kiddo’s father were acquainted. 

@espn ♬ original sound - ESPN

Ultimately, this emotional “22” moment is what ended up in Swift’s Eras Tour film to represent all the Swifties who have had the honor of receiving the hat. 

Taylor Swift performing 22 at the Eras Tour in the film

Swifties Who Are Prominent On Social Media Also Get The “22” Hat

Along with little Swifties and friends of the pop star getting the hat, the singer and her team will choose fans who are popular online. 

For example, the "Cruel Summer" singer notability gave her hat to 22-year-old TikTok star Mikael Arellano, who originated the viral dance to “Bejeweled” that Swift replicates in her choreography on tour, during one of her shows.

The L.A.-based milliner Gladys Tamez worked in collaboration to create a custom hat for Taylor’s use on the Eras Tour. The hat’s style appears to be a blend of a pork pie and 70s fedora.

In continuing an old tradition from the RED Tour, Taylor signs the underside of the hat’s brim to hand out to a lucky fan each night. The Gladys Tamez team confirmed to me that enough hats were made to last the whole tour.

Worn with:  Ashish shirt ,  Ashish bodysuit , and  Christian Louboutin oxfords

Dissecting the many stages of Taylor Swift ’s music — and corresponding style — has become an international pastime, especially during the run of her Eras tour. And a perpetual fan favorite? Her Red era. To refresh your memory: The Red album was released on October 22, 2012, and the corresponding Red tour ran from March 2013 to June 2014. Of course, we were treated to a part two when her re-recorded Red (Taylor’s Version) came out on November 12, 2021.

Not only was Red a groundbreaking moment in Swift’s musical transition from country star to pop star, it was also a pivotal time in her style evolution. Swift was 22 when the album came out (and famously wrote a song about the formative age), and she started to leave behind some of the styles of the teenage years when she first became famous. She traded flowing curls for blunt bangs and princessy gowns for high-waisted short-shorts and edgier hats, and naturally, wore so much bright red — clothing and lipstick both. 

One of her most enduring songs of the era, “All Too Well” clearly detailed a relationship that took place in the fall, and so lots of cozy sweaters, plaid patterns, and of course, scarves, also featured prominently in her everyday wardrobe during these years. 

Now, as fans are recreating Red looks for the Eras tour, they’re wearing black and white blouses (an homage to the Red cover art), recreations of the notorious “Not a Lot Going on at the Moment” T-shirt from her “22” video, and crimson shorts with sparkly tops. The lucky one! Taylor Swift offered the hat she wore while performing “22” to a dancer in the audience of her concert in Arlington, Texas, on Sunday night.

The Swiftie, Jaylan Ford, posted the sweet moment on TikTok, writing, “Omggg!! Im soo happy @taylorswift @taylornation gave me her hat [and] signed it for me omggg!! I couldn’t even sleep man im a swiftie for life be outside today.”

Taylor Swift and Selena Gomez’s Little Sister Sweetly Exchanged Gifts During Texas ‘Eras…

Trending on billboard.

The surprise gift capped what was already a magical night for the Texas-based dancer, whose mom crowdfunded the floor-seat ticket by launching a GoFundMe page . “My name is Alena I’m Jaylan’s mom and I’m setting this up for our beloved Jaylan Ford to fulfill one of Jaylan’s BIGGEST DREAMS!! Which is to see Taylor Swift! Jaylan can be seen rocking it out on Cooper Street just about every day! Jaylan dances to bring smiles to faces and loves dancing for the city!!” she wrote on the fundraiser page, which ultimately brought in a total of $3,178 through more than a hundred mostly anonymous donations.

The night before, Swift gave her hat to another fan: Selena Gomez’s younger sister Gracie Teefey. The 9-year-old sweetly offered her famous sister’s equally famous BFF a handmade friendship bracelet in exchange for the item of clothing.

The surprises keep coming on the Paris leg of Taylor Swift 's Eras Tour!

When Swift's record-breaking tour kicked off again on Thursday, May 9, at La Défense Arena, Swifties were treated to a very new show than they have seen in past cities.

Along with many outfit changes during the performance, the pop star, 34, added songs from her latest album, The Tortured Poets Department , to her setlist.

One Eras tour tradition that Swift kept, however, was wearing a custom Ashish Gupta T-shirt while performing her hit "22" during the Red (Taylor's Version) portion of the show. At Thursday night's show, the shirt turned heads, reading "This Is Not Taylor's Version" instead of displaying lyrics from her songs, as the garment usually does.

But, as seen on the official Eras Tour X (formerly Twitter) account, the "Down Bad" singer returned to tradition during Friday night's show at La Défense.

Never miss a story — sign up for PEOPLE's free daily newsletter to stay up-to-date on the best of what PEOPLE has to offer​​, from celebrity news to compelling human interest stories. 

"TAYLOR SWIFT STUNS IN NEW 'RED' 22 SHIRT FOR TONIGHT'S SHOW OF 'THE ERAS TOUR' IN PARIS, FRANCE! #ParisTSTheErasTour ," read the text above a photo of Swift in a shirt reading "I BET YOU THINK ABOUT ME." The "All Too Well" singer also sported her usual black hat with the outfit as she sang.

"I Bet You Think About Me" is Swift's duet with Chris Stapleton , featured on Red (Taylor's Version ).

Swift's performance of "22" has become a highlight of her concerts, as she often gifts the hat to a special audience member — like a young girl with cancer and late basketball star Kobe Bryant 's daughter Bianka .

The "Fortnight" singer also made the sweet gesture on Friday night in Paris.

16-Year-Old Taylor Swift Fan Who Was Gifted “22” Hat on Eras Tour Dies After Her Cancer Returns (Exclusive)

"Taylor’s music brought light to Ally’s life," says Patty Garner Anderson of her 16-year-old daughter, who died in November after living with cancer for 5 years

Patty Garner Anderson will always remember the smile on her daughter Ally's face at Taylor Swift's Eras Tour stop on July 1 in Cincinnati. Swift danced her way down the stage and handed Ally the famous fedora from her "22" costume.

"It changed my daughter's life immensely," Patty tells PEOPLE exclusively. "I hadn’t seen Ally smile and laugh like that in a very long time."

Ally, who had been living with cancer since 2018, posted a TikTok video from that night that shows her standing in a bathroom placing the hat on her head, then putting her hand over her mouth. "what happened," she captioned the video. She shared another video on TikTok from the moment Swift placed the hat on her head.

"no words to describe what it felt like to be pulled from my seats to the floor," she writes. "I knew immediately. taylor was my first concert so many years ago. honestly such a full circle moment."

Related: Taylor Swift Gifts '22' Hat to Dancer After Arlington Community Raises Over $1000 for His Floor Seat

Patty says she and Ally were original Swift fans. When Ally was 8 years old, her very first concert was the Taylor Swift 1989 World Tour in 2015.

But in September 2018, when she was 11, Ally's life changed. She was diagnosed with Stage 4 alveolar rhabdomyosarcoma , a rare soft tissue cancer. Throughout her battle with cancer, Patty says Taylor’s music constantly "brought light to Ally’s life."

Like so many fans, "she knew every single word to every single song," says Patty, describing Ally as “kind, loving, fierce."

Her love for Swift's music was obvious. “Ally had her music playing when she was still able to shower, when she was organizing her room, when we drove anywhere. It truly is all she played.”

Ally even got a tattoo on her left forearm featuring lyrics from Swift's song, "The 1": "And if you never bleed, you're never gonna grow."

Through social media, Ally found connections with "Swiftie" friends who were also fighting childhood cancer. "It gave her an escape and a sense of belonging," Patty explains.

It's one reason that night in July was so special to her.

"We had the opportunity to meet Taylor’s mom Andrea at the concert," Patty says. "We couldn’t thank her enough for choosing Ally for the hat, but I hope one day I can meet Taylor and Andrea to express how much that night meant to Ally."

After five years of fighting cancer, Ally died on Nov. 13 at 16 years old.

Ally's mom sees the significance. "As you know Taylor Swift’s favorite number is 13. Ally passed away on 11/13/23 at 13:40. The 13th day during the 13th hour.”

Taylor Swift ’s Eras Tour has taken the world by storm, and while the three-hour show is all about celebrating her discography, the singer’s No. 1 concern is the safety of her fans.

Swift has even paused her show multiple times during her world tour to alert security of struggling fans in the crowd in hopes of getting them assistance quickly. The Eras Tour has featured cutting-edge technology with its lighting designs and laser effects, and Swift has previously discussed how her performance isn’t the only thing that requires a lot of planning.

Before embarking on her Reputation tour in 2018, Swift said she was deeply impacted after 22 people were killed as a result of a bombing during Ariana Grande ’s concert in Manchester.

“I was completely terrified to go on tour this time because I didn’t know how we were going to keep 3 million fans safe over seven months,” Swift told Elle in 2019. “There was a tremendous amount of planning, expense, and effort put into keeping my fans safe. My fear of violence has continued into my personal life.”

Breaking Down All of Taylor Swifts Eras Tour Surprise Song Mash Ups and What They Could Mean

Related: A Guide to All of Taylor Swift's 'Eras' Surprise Songs

The Eras Tour has been an even bigger endeavor for Swift. In December 2023, it was reported that an estimated 4.35 million tickets had been sold across her 60 concerts in North America, Argentina and Brazil before she embarked on the international leg of her tour.

Keeping fans safe is no small feat, and in addition to copious amounts of preliminary safety measures and a top-notch security team, Swift takes personal responsibility for her fans’ experience — even when she’s on stage.

Keep reading to see every time Swift paused the Eras Tours to ask security to help with a distressed fan.

Philadelphia, Pennsylvania

Swift interrupted her performance of “Bad Blood” during a May 2023 Eras show to call off a security guard who got into an altercation with a fan.

“She’s fine,” Swift could be heard yelling into the crowd, apparently frustrated by what she saw from her security team. The singer paused again to add, “She wasn’t doing anything,” before yelling, “Hey, stop” two more times.

Rio de Janeiro, Brazil

Swift and her fans braved extreme heat during the string of shows in Brazil in November 2023. One concertgoer, Ana Clara Benevides , died of heat exhaustion before a Rio show.

Every Time Taylor Swift Has Asked Security to Help Fans During Eras Tour

Swift did her best to help fans, and during her performance, she repeatedly asked her off-stage team to provide water to the crowd.

“There’s people that need water right here, maybe 30, 35, 40 feet back,” she said on stage during the Evermore set, pointing to a floor section of the crowd. “So whoever is in charge of giving them that, just make sure that happens. Can I get a signal that you know where they are?”
